New Delhi: Rohith Vemula, a Dalit scholar at University of Hyderabad, committed suicide following a long discrimination by the University authorities. 

The 28-year-old, a second year research scholar of science, technology and society studies department, was found hanging in his friend's room in the hostel on Sunday.

The protests over suicide of a Dalit research scholar rocked University of Hyderabad while police booked central minister Bandaru Dattatreya and three others for abetment of suicide and also for violations of the SC/ST act.
